Transaction cecbabf964893e77c8b2772a9dacf55365e0b2c0fa8a15901b081daa16e8ec50
1 Input
1 Output
-
cecbabf964893e77c8b2772a9dacf55365e0b2c0fa8a15901b081daa16e8ec50:0
- value
- 28572904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b95ce75273842b9ee67e31dde307dcff3e4bc9d1 OP_EQUAL
- address
- MQoGXyTb3stA9H1dREnrpEJiv2qz9Mnw4z